Street Fighter 6 Season 2 Is the Capcom vs SNK Sequel We’ve Dreamed of for Years

A crossover we could only dream of

Summer Game Fest started off with a bang, and Capcom was no slouch. Street Fighter 6 fans were expecting some news on the future, but no one could have expected the bombshell the Japanese gaming giant dropped. Season 2 of Street Fighter 6 is confirmed to have fan favorites from older games and even some crossover characters we never thought possible.

Season 2 of Street Fighter 6 will get the ever-alive and unkillable boss, M. Bison, who may look beaten up and bruised, but the maniacal smirk hasn’t gone amiss. The second returning character is Elena, who was a fan favorite for SF3 players but also the absolute bane of SF4 fans due to her ability to increase her health and prolong the battle.

Leaving both of those amazing reveals in the dust are the SNK fighters Terry and Mai, who have crossed over from Fatal Fury to Street Fighter 6’s Season 2 roster. The reveal left fans screaming at the top of their lungs at the Summer Game Fest 2024 show floor. 

Street Fighter 6 Season 2 Trailer & Characters Release Dates

Capcom showed a small animated trailer that showed Luke and Jamie playing on an arcade machine and then moved on to showing other characters joining the fray. The trailer just confirmed the characters coming for Season 2 but didn’t show any in-game footage or gameplay since they are likely not ready yet. Terry looks more like his classic design instead of the makeover he got in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ves, but the same can not be said about Mai since she hasn’t been revealed yet.

What Capcom did confirm were the release dates for each character in Street Fighter 6 season 2. M. Bison will be the first psycho crushing his way into Street Fighter 6 in Summer 2024. Terry will be following close behind and start Power Waving Street Fighter characters in Autumn 2024. Elena will be released in Spring 2024, while the queen of SNK, Mai Shiranui will aptly be throwing her burning fans during Winter 2025. But before you tune out, Capcom confirmed on Twitter that M. Bison will get a gameplay trailer in only a few hours.

Capcom vs Snk Fans Left Quaking in Excitement

This is a massive throwback to the days of Capcom vs SNK 2, also colloquially known as CvS2, that fighting game fans thought would remain relegated to a bygone era of fighting game crossovers. No one could have possibly expected characters from a different fighting game to come to a mainline Street Fighter game because it has never happened before. 

Perhaps the success of crossover characters in Tekken 7 swayed Capcom into finally including characters that aren’t canonical to the series. Bandai Namco not only added Akuma to Tekken 7 but also added characters that, at first glance, made no sense. Characters like Negan from The Walking Dead and Noctis from Final Fantasy XV were expertly weaved into the narrative and fighting style of Tekken. This could also mean that Capcom’s future strategy for Street Fighter 6 will include more characters from competing fighting game franchises, other Capcom IPs, or even beyond. 

Luckily, none of the characters were leaked like the launch of SF6 and the fighters that later joined the roster in season 1. Street Fighter 6 is available on P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, Xbox Series X|S, and PC.
